THE OPPORTUNITY

Western Forest Products has an exciting opportunity for a Content and Media Specialist based in Vancouver, BC. Passionate about the art of storytelling, the Content & Media Specialist works as part of the Corporate Affairs team and closely with business units including Partnerships and Sustainability, Human Resources, and the Executive team to curate and develop content strategies and plans to enhance engagement and understanding of Western’s business practices with targeted audiences leveraging appropriate channels.

The Content & Media Specialist is an excellent writer, first and foremost, who has a thirst for telling great stories. The position is responsible for develop a compelling brand narrative and supporting it through print, web, intranet and social media strategy and execution.

ABOUT WESTERN FOREST PRODUCTS

Western Forest Products is a Canadian forest products company that sustainably manages forests and manufactures high-quality wood products. We are committed to providing the most sustainable building products on the planet. With operations in the coastal region of British Columbia and Washington State, Western Forest Products meets the needs of customers worldwide with a specialty wood products focus and diverse product offering sourced from our secure access to a variety of coastal BC tree species. Our progressive approach to safe and sustainable forestry practices and large investment in manufacturing ensures the health and prosperity of our forests, communities and business for generations to come.
